The Asia Pacific Photovoltaic Relay Market Has Experienced Significant Growth Due To The Increased Demand For Solar Energy Across The Region. As Industries Push Towards Greener Solutions And Renewable Energy Alternatives, Photovoltaic Relays Are Becoming A Critical Component In The Efficiency Of Solar Energy Systems. These Relays Help Control The Flow Of Electricity In Photovoltaic Systems, Protecting Equipment From Damage Due To Fluctuations In Power And Ensuring Smooth Operation. The Diverse Industrial Needs For These Relays Are Shaping The Growth Of The Market, As Companies Look For More Reliable And Efficient Solutions To Manage Power Distribution.
Manufacturers Of Photovoltaic Relays Are Catering To Various Sectors That Rely On Solar Power. The Residential Sector Demands Smaller, More Affordable Photovoltaic Relays To Optimize Home Solar Panels, While The Commercial Sector Seeks Advanced Relays With Higher Capacity For Larger Systems. Furthermore, The Industrial Sector, Which Often Uses Photovoltaic Systems For Large-Scale Operations, Demands Highly Durable And Efficient Relays Capable Of Withstanding Harsh Conditions. Industries Such As Agriculture, Manufacturing, And Mining Are Increasingly Adopting Solar Energy To Cut Operational Costs And Reduce Their Carbon Footprint.
The Demand From Industries For Photovoltaic Relays Is Not Just Based On Capacity But Also On Performance Under Extreme Conditions. Relays Must Be Able To Handle High-Voltage Fluctuations, High Temperatures, And Provide Fail-Safe Operations To Ensure Uninterrupted Energy Flow. This Has Pushed Manufacturers To Innovate And Produce Relays That Not Only Meet The Basic Functionality But Also Enhance The Overall Efficiency Of Photovoltaic Systems. The Rise Of Solar Power Farms, Particularly In Countries Like China And India, Is One Of The Key Drivers Of The Photovoltaic Relay Market.
Moreover, Industries Require Relays That Can Be Integrated Seamlessly Into Automated Systems. The Increasing Trend Of Automation In Energy Management Systems Is Influencing The Demand For Photovoltaic Relays That Offer Intelligent Features, Such As Remote Monitoring And Predictive Maintenance. As The Asia Pacific Photovoltaic Relay Market Continues To Grow, The Focus Will Be On Developing More Advanced, Cost-Effective, And Reliable Relays To Support The Expanding Solar Energy Infrastructure In The Region.
